Iraqi leader calls for unity, political stability (AP)

Iraqi Prime Minister Nouri al- Maliki speaks to his supporters in Baghdad, Iraq. Saturday, Dec. 31, 2011. Iraq's prime minister says the end of the American military presence in Iraq is a new dawn for his country. (AP Photo/Karim Kadim)AP - Iraq's prime minister is calling for greater political stability to ensure the country's security after the end of the American military presence.
